One of the standout features of this restaurant is its extensive menu, showcasing a variety of delicious wraps and hearty bowls. Here are some highlights:

  • Caesar Wrap: Crisp romaine, asiago cheese, and creamy Caesar dressing come together in a satisfying wrap, perfect for those who appreciate classic flavors. Priced at $11.95, it’s a must-try!
  • Buffalo Wrap: For a kick of spice, indulge in the Buffalo Wrap, featuring romaine, cheddar, and creamy buffalo sauce, also at $11.95.
  • Teriyaki Bowl: Delight in steamed mixed veggies drizzled with your choice of regular or spicy teriyaki sauce, available at $11.95. It's a great option for those looking for a hearty, nutritious meal!
  • Fajita Bowl: With red pepper, zucchini, avocado, and a touch of jalapeño cilantro sauce, this bowl, priced at $13.15, is bursting with flavor!

Aside from their wraps and bowls, Crazy Bowls & Wraps also offers a range of appetizing starters. From crispy chicken bites to vegetable wontons, there’s a delightful starter for everyone. What’s more, the BBQ Wrap and Mediterranean Wrap are perfect for those who want to explore diverse tastes!

I hadn't been to CB&W in a very long time so I thought I'd order takeout of a few options to eat over the next 3 days at the time: -Chicken Tex Mex Egg Roll (3 ct) -Lobster Rangoon (3 ct) -Chicken Power Bowl -Queso and Chips -Jalapeno Cilantro Dipping Sauce -Crunchy Chicken Buffalo Chicken Wrap -Chocolate rice krispy treat My order was already ready and hot when I placed it online and walked over to pick it up. The store was very clean and organized. The queso and chips are FIRE. It's the perfect balance of runny and thick. The chips are the perfect thiness and crispness for my liking. The lobster rolls although small, were pretty good with the dipping sauce it came with. The chicken tex mex egg roll was slightly oversaturated in oil and a little burnt but definitely in the ballpark with Chili's renowned Southwestern Egg Rolls. The sauce it comes with is equally delicious! You must try dipping this in the Jalapeno Cilantro dipping sauce. You will not be disappointed! I was not impressed with the chicken power bowl. I think it had way too much corn and rice. There was a lot of beans and the chicken was dry as well. The crispy buffalo chicken wrap was very delicious but I'd skip the rice the next time :-) I wasn't a fan of the chocolate rice krispy treat. I think the marshmallow part was too synthetic tasting for me.
